I have a 95 Chevy Lumina 3.4l engine. The problem I have is a check engine light that comes on and the car start jerking like is running out of fuel. I pull off the road and restart the car and there's no check engine light on; I drive it for a few miles and light comes back on until I restart to clear the light. Do yoiu have any ideal what could cause that condition

The fault could be almost anything from a failing ignition coil through wiring and connections or a failing fuel pump to a faulty ECU.

When the ECU detects a fault it switches on the engine check light and uses programmed values to get you home and mostly very little difference in performance can be detected. The fact your engine stops indicates something necessary is dying, such as the spark or the fuel supply.

When the engine check light is switched on, details of the fault are stored in the memory of the ECU which can be read with a scanner or code reader. Sometimes a code isn't recorded which indicates the fault is outside the scope of the engine management system.

Best practice means before resorting to electronic diagnosis is checking the basics first; detailed visual inspection, ensuring the routine maintenance is up to date and competently carried out...

SOURCE: 1991 Chevy Lumina 3.1 Sedan Starting/Dying Problems

Ok this was all after the car was all warmed up how far can you go from a cold start until it "dies:?
I want to suspect a crank sensor or ignition module just because of the symptoms if nothing happens until the egine gets hot ,typical of a failing crank sensor andignition module, always replace them togother.
But there is one more culprit, the catalytic Converter, see they break up inside and over time the catalyist bounces around and becomes a ball, on acceleration the presssure of the exhaust pushes the "ball' of caytlist into the exhaust pipe opening restricting it until it shuts off the car. You pull over the pressure goes away the "ball" falls back into the cat, you start again and it starts all over again. I would hve the cat tested and you can do a test yourself hit the cat on the bottom with a hammer and if you hear some rattling inside when you hit it yhe catalist is broken and is likely your problem.

SOURCE: 2009 chevy silverado traction control


DTC P1516 Throttle Actuator Control (TAC) Module Throttle Actuator Position Performance

Your vehicle has an electronic throttle body unit so it uses voltage signals to control throttle blade in the throttle body. There are a few different issues that can cause this problem.

First off there is a update for the PCM to address those codes, but you will have to take it to the dealer for that.

Second there is issues with the actuator on the throttle body binding up and causing the codes.
